What Is Hotel Inventory Management in 2026?

Modern hotel inventory management goes beyond room counts. Today’s inventory systems support forecasting, integrate with PMS and POS platforms, and enable centralized control across multiple channels and properties. The goal is to ensure that every room is priced, allocated, and sold accurately at the right time, through the right channel.

Strategy 3: Use Demand Forecasting to Allocate Inventory Strategically 

Why this matters in 2026: Selling inventory blindly across channels limits revenue during peak demand.

The problem -

  • Reactive pricing and allocation
  • Missed high-demand windows due to poor forecasting

The strategy - Forecast demand using historical booking data, seasonality, local events, and OTA trends. Allocate inventory dynamically to higher-performing channels instead of spreading it evenly.

Strategy 4: Implement Smart Overbooking Controls Without Hurting Guest Experience

Why this matters in 2026 - Overbooking missteps damage reputation faster than ever.

The problem -

  • Static buffers or no buffers at all
  • Last-minute relocations that hurt guest satisfaction

The strategy - Use controlled overbooking rules such as channel-wise allotment caps and small buffers (1–2 rooms), based on demand patterns and historical behavior.
